Overlooking the Chicago River just off Michigan Avenue at Wacker Drive, Hotel 71 is a destination for those looking for an alternative to the mainstream four-star hotels. Travelers enjoy a unique and memorable experience melding style, comfort, functionality, and a high level of service and breath-taking views of Chicago without sacrificing a single amenity.
With its central location on the Chicago River on Wacker Drive just off Michigan Avenue, Hotel 71 breaks with ordinary conventions as the first Chicago hotel of its kind to cater to business travelers, tourists and locals alike looking for a smart, stylish and reliable experience with a Chicago sensibility.
The Hotel 71 has recently completed installation of brand new guest room elevators.
Property Amenities
An on-site fitness room is open 24 hours, and guests receive discounted access to a health club two blocks away (spa services, fitness classes, and indoor lap pool). Hotel 71 also houses 16 meeting rooms, including 8 boardroom suites and a glass-enclosed penthouse with panoramic city views audiovisual equipment and complimentary high-speed internet access are available. A 24-hour business center provides complimentary high speed and wireless internet access and printing capabilities. The pet policy includes a $100 non refundable deposit with a max. 25 pound weight restriction.

Hotel address: 71 East Wacker Drive, Chicago, IL 60601
Magnificent Mile, Wacker Drive, The Loop, Gold Coast, River North
Chicago O'Hare, Chicago Midway
One block west of Michigan Avenue on East Wacker Drive, on the Chicago River, Shopping, Theatre District and the Loop.
Hours:6AM-10PM. 71 Café offers breakfast, lunch, dinner, and drinks. The Café has a selection of Grab & Go items along with specialty coffees. Lunch offers a full service menu with soups, fresh salads, and made to order sandwiches. There is a full service dinner menu with great appetizers. The Café’s full service bar, where you can enjoy a glass of wine, your favorite martini, or our fine selection of beer. Complimentary Wi-Fi is available.
In-Room Dining available daily from 6:30AM-11PM
7,000 square feet of meeting facilities available.
